"Checkmate" is a word in ENGLISH

checkmate ENGLISH
Definition:

To check (an adversary's king) in such a manner that
escape in impossible; to defeat (an adversary) by putting his king in
check from which there is no escape.

checkmate ENGLISH
Definition:

The position in the game of chess when a king is in
check and cannot be released, -- which ends the game.

checkmate ENGLISH
Definition:

A complete check; utter defeat or overthrow.

checkmate ENGLISH
Definition:

To defeat completely; to terminate; to thwart.
